搜索引擎优化SEO流程

搜索引擎优化(SEO)是一项通过改进网站结构和内容,提高网站在搜索引擎中的排名,从而增加网站流量的技术和策略。SEO的主要目标是使网站在用户搜索相关关键词时,能够在搜索引擎结果页面中排名靠前。这对于企业和个人网站都是至关重要的,因为高排名通常意味着更多的曝光和更多的商机。

二、关键词研究与优化

关键词是用户在搜索引擎中输入的词语或短语,所以选择合适的关键词是SEO的关键步骤之一。通过使用一些关键词研究工具,可以找到与网站内容相关且搜索量较高的关键词。在选择关键词后,需要将其合理地应用到网站的标题、meta标签、文本内容等位置,以提高网站在搜索引擎中的可见度。

三、网站结构优化

优化网站结构是为了让搜索引擎更好地读取和理解网站内容。需要保证每个网页都有一个独特的URL,并使用简洁的文件夹结构来组织网页。建议使用HTML或XML网站地图,以提供一个全面的网站目录,便于搜索引擎抓取网页。还可以通过内部链接来增加网页之间的联系,提高网站的整体权威度。

四、内容优化与推广

优质内容是吸引用户并提高网站排名的核心。要确保网站的内容是独特、有价值的,并且与目标受众的需求相吻合。应注重关键词密度的控制,以避免过度使用或滥用关键词,影响阅读体验和搜索引擎的判断。通过社交媒体、博客和相关论坛等渠道进行内容推广,增加网站的曝光度和链接数量,进一步提高网站在搜索引擎中的可信度和权威性。

搜索引擎优化SEO是一项既具有挑战性又必不可少的任务。借助合适的关键词研究和网站结构优化,可以提高网站在搜索引擎中的可见性。通过优化网站内容的质量和推广渠道,可以吸引更多的用户并提高网站的排名。SEO流程是一个复杂而长期的工作,需要不断地调整和优化,以适应搜索引擎算法的变化和用户需求的变化。只有在持续努力的基础上,才能实现网站的长期发展和成功。

C语言程序设计项目化教程

C语言是一门广泛应用于计算机科学和软件开发领域的编程语言,它以其高效性、灵活性和可扩展性而闻名。对于想要学习和掌握C语言的初学者来说,了解如何进行项目化的学习和实践是至关重要的。本文将为读者介绍C语言程序设计项目化教程,帮助他们系统地学习和掌握C语言的应用。

一、项目化学习的重要性

在学习和掌握编程语言时,项目化学习是一种非常有效的方法。通过参与和完成实际项目,学习者可以将所学知识应用于实践中,提高自己的编程能力和解决问题的能力。在C语言编程中,项目化学习可以帮助学习者理解语法规则、掌握算法和数据结构,并培养实际开发中所需的代码组织和调试技巧。

二、确定项目的主题和目标

在进行C语言项目化学习时,首先需要确定一个明确的项目主题和目标。这个主题和目标可以是一个简单的程序解决某个具体问题,也可以是一个复杂的应用程序的开发,具体取决于学习者的经验和能力。通过明确的主题和目标,学习者可以更加有针对性地学习和实践。

三、分析和设计项目的需求

在确定项目主题和目标后,接下来需要进行需求分析和设计。这一步骤是项目成功的关键,它要求学习者仔细分析实际需求,设计合理的程序结构和算法。通过分析和设计,学习者可以为项目奠定良好的基础,减少后期开发和调试的难度。

四、编写代码和调试

在完成项目的需求分析和设计后,学习者可以开始编写代码并进行调试。在这一阶段,学习者需要根据需求和设计,使用C语言的语法和工具,逐步将代码编写出来,并进行测试和调试。通过不断调试和优化,学习者能够提高代码的质量和程序的性能。

五、项目的扩展和改进

一旦项目的基本功能实现并通过测试,学习者可以考虑进一步扩展和改进项目。这可以包括添加新的功能、优化算法、优化用户界面等。通过不断地改进项目,学习者能够提高自己的编程能力和解决问题的能力。

六、与其他开发者交流和合作

在进行C语言项目化学习的过程中,学习者还可以主动与其他开发者进行交流和合作。通过与其他开发者的沟通和合作,学习者能够获得更多的经验和知识,并且在项目中得到更多的反馈和建议。通过与其他开发者的合作,学习者可以锻炼自己的团队合作和沟通能力。

七、整理和文档化项目

在项目完成后,学习者应该对项目进行整理和文档化。这包括整理代码、编写文档、记录项目的开发过程和心得体会等。通过整理和文档化,学习者可以巩固对项目的理解,并且为后续的学习和实践提供参考。

C语言程序设计项目化教程可以帮助初学者系统地学习和掌握C语言的应用。通过参与实际项目的学习和实践,学习者能够提高自己的编程能力和解决问题的能力。在学习和实践的过程中,学习者需要不断分析和设计项目的需求,编写和调试代码,并与其他开发者进行交流和合作。通过不断扩展和改进项目,并对项目进行整理和文档化,学习者能够更好地巩固所学知识并积累经验。希望本文的介绍能够对C语言初学者的学习和实践有所帮助。

PYTHON编程入门教程

引言

PYTHON编程语言作为一种高级编程语言,具有简洁、易读、易学的特点,在计算机科学领域被广泛应用。本篇文章将系统介绍“PYTHON编程入门教程”的相关知识,旨在帮助读者快速掌握PYTHON编程的基本概念和技能。

正文

Python编程可以分为多个方面进行分类。Python是一种对象导向的编程语言,通过将现实世界的事物抽象成对象,以便更好地组织和管理代码。可以使用Python创建一个名称为“student”的类,该类具有属性(如姓名、年龄、成绩等)和方法(如计算平均成绩、获取学生信息等)。通过创建类的实例(即对象),可以使用这些属性和方法来操作学生的相关信息。

Python是一种脚本语言,可以通过编写脚本文件来批量执行代码。这种特性使得Python非常适用于自动化任务,例如批量处理文件、网页爬虫等。脚本文件可以按照顺序执行一系列指令,从而实现自动化的功能。可以编写一个Python脚本来自动下载一系列网页,并提取其中的数据进行分析。

Python还是一种通用的编程语言,可以用于开发各种类型的应用程序,包括网站、桌面应用、移动应用等。Python拥有丰富的第三方库和框架,可以简化开发过程。使用Django框架可以快速构建大规模的Web应用程序,而使用PyQt可以轻松创建跨平台的桌面应用。

Python编程入门教程通常会涵盖以下内容:Python基本语法、变量和数据类型、控制流程(如循环和条件语句)、函数、模块和包、文件操作、异常处理、面向对象编程等。对于初学者来说,理解和掌握这些基础知识是很重要的,因为它们构成了Python编程的基石。

举例来说,Python中的变量可以存储不同类型的数据,如整数、浮点数、字符串等。变量的命名是灵活的,可以根据需要起一个容易理解的名称。可以使用变量名“count”存储一个整数,表示某个计数值。通过使用赋值符号“=”,可以将一个值赋给变量。可以将count的值设置为10,然后在代码中使用它进行计算或比较。

另一个例子是控制流程中的循环语句。在Python中,有两种常用的循环语句:for循环和while循环。for循环用于遍历一个可迭代对象(如列表、字符串等),执行一系列语句。可以使用for循环遍历一个列表中的元素,并对每个元素进行特定的操作。而while循环在满足一定条件的情况下,会不断地执行一段代码块。可以使用while循环实现一个简单的猜数字游戏,直到用户猜对为止。

结尾

通过本文的介绍,读者可以初步了解“PYTHON编程入门教程”的相关知识。作为一种简洁、易读、易学的编程语言,Python在行业中具有广泛的应用前景。希望读者能够通过学习和实践,掌握Python编程的基础知识,为今后的学习和工作打下坚实的基础。

注意:文章总字数为429字,根据要求800字到2000字之间,还需要进一步扩展内容。